Can you create a double shadow in an org chart?
I was given an printed document of an org chart that shows a double shadow,
either I am unable to find that option or it was created by adding a figure
to the picture.

Any feedback?

I am not aware of any Organization Chart shapes that have double shadows by
default which are included with Visio out of box, a person can always create
a custom shape. You can modify the position, color, pattern and transparency
of the shadow for the shapes include with Visio’s Organization stencil.
